Abstract

The utility model discloses an automatic ammonium nitrate bag breaking and feeding device which comprises a rack, an indexing motor, a main shaft, a bearing pedestal, a rotating disc, fixed plates, bag hanging needles, a pushing mechanism, a cutting knife mechanism, a bag unloading mechanism and an impacting mechanism, wherein the indexing motor is arranged at the top of the rack, a shaft of the indexing motor is inserted into a connection hole at the top of the main shaft to be fixed, the main shaft is fixed at the upper part of the rack through the bearing pedestal, the bottom of the main shaft is fixed with the rotating disc, the outer edge of the rotating disc is provided with the fixed plates, the bag hanging needles are arranged on the fixed plates, the pushing mechanism and the cutting knife mechanism are arranged at one side of the rack, the impacting mechanism is fixed on the rack where the pushing mechanism clockwise rotates for 90 degrees, and the bag unloading mechanism is fixed in the rack where the pushing mechanism counterclockwise rotates for 90 degrees. The device disclosed by the utility model can be matched for use with the existing industrial explosive continuous production line, has the advantages of high yield and low labor strength, and is suitable for ammonium nitrate bag breaking and feeding.

Background technology
During Industrial Explosive in Our Country was produced, ammonium nitrate was main raw material(s), accounts for about 85% of explosive proportioning, calculated by producing the 12000t commercial explosive per year, needed the broken about 10000t of total amount that feeds intake.
In the prior art production process; The damaged feeding mode of the ammonium nitrate that commercial explosive production is taked is: earlier packaging bag is scratched by the site operation personnel is manual; Broken with mallet or "painted-face" character in opera again, be broken into and drop into comminutor after certain lumpiness and pulverize, add through feedway then and dissolve in the equipment; Because the broken inventory of this operation is big, adopt technical approach to fall behind; Need to be equipped with several broken personnel; And site work environment is poor, labour intensity is big; Emphasis characteristic (high automation degree-minimizing hazardous area operating personal, the high efficiency-online quantity of minimizing dangerous material, the high reliability-less trouble of the recent technology innovation of the quick-fried industry of the people that Commission of Science, Technology and Industry for National Defence clearly proposes can not have been satisfied in " the quick-fried industry five big major tasks of the people in 2008 "; High security) strengthens requirements such as commercial explosive automation control, reduction labour intensity, minimizing hazardous area operating personal in, be unfavorable for the development of commercial explosive continuous production technology.

The specific embodiment
Like Fig. 1, shown in 2; The broken automatically bag charging device of ammonium nitrate; Comprise frame 1, indexing motor 2, main shaft 3, bearing seat 4, rotating disk 5, adapter plate 6, hang bag pin 7, pusher 8, cutter knife mechanism 9, bleed mechanism 10, hit material mechanism 11; Said indexing motor 2 is installed on the top of frame 1, and indexing motor 2 main shafts insert the connecting bore at main shaft 3 tops and fix; Main shaft 3 is fixed in frame 1 top through bearing seat 4, and main shaft 3 bottoms are rotating disk 5 fixedly, and rotating disk 5 outer rims are provided with adapter plate 6, installs on the adapter plate 6 and hangs bag pin 7; Pusher 8 and cutter knife mechanism 9 are installed on a side of frame 1, hit material mechanism 11 and are fixed on the frame 1 of pusher 8 left-hand revolutions 90 degree, and bleed mechanism 10 is fixed in the frame 1 that pusher 8 dextrorotations turn 90 degrees.
Said pusher 8 is formed for hydraulic actuating cylinder connects a push pedal.
Said cutter knife mechanism 9 is for hydraulic actuating cylinder and blade connect to form, and circular shear blade is installed on the hydraulic cylinder piston rod.
Said bleed mechanism 10 is a movable fork, connects hydraulic actuating cylinder in the middle of the movable fork.
Said hit the material mechanism 11 comprise driven hit flitch, initiatively hit flitch and hydraulic actuating cylinder the composition, the driven flitch that hits is installed on frame 1 inner rotary table 5 belows, initiatively hits flitch and hydraulic actuating cylinder and is installed on frame 1 side.
Packed ammonium nitrate falls into pusher 8 front ends automatically through band conveyor 12 during work, and system detects packed ammonium nitrate and passes through, and the packed ammonium nitrate of pusher 8 promotions makes to be suspended on it to be hung on the bag pin 7.Indexing motor 2 drives rotating disk 5 left-hand revolutions 90 degree through main shaft 3 behind pusher 8 returns; Cutter knife mechanism 9 was cut ammonium nitrate packaging bag bottom after rotation put in place; Cutter knife mechanism 9 returns; Hit material mechanism 11 bump ammonium nitrate and make its preliminary fragmentation, pass through ammonium nitrate deadweight blanking, pusher 8 is suspended on another bag ammonium nitrate and hangs a bag pin 7 simultaneously.Pusher 8 with hit material mechanism 11 simultaneously behind the return, indexing motor 2 drives rotating disks 5 left-hand revolutions 90 degree through main shaft 3, the ammonium nitrate blanking is complete, simultaneously pusher 8, cutter knife mechanism 9, hit material mechanism 11 and repeat a step and move.Pusher 8 with hit material mechanism 11 simultaneously behind the return, indexing motor 2 drives rotating disks 5 left-hand revolutions 90 degree through main shaft 3, put in place fork in the back bleed mechanism 10 of rotation is swung laterally and packaging bag is come off hang a bag pin 7, the packaging bag of fork return comes off.
The utlity model has advantages such as simple in structure, that production capacity is high, labour intensity is low, can be in the direct supporting use of existing commercial explosive continuous production line.
